What Pennsylvania Employers Look For

The qualifications that appear most often in area manager jobs across Pennsylvania.

  • Bachelor's degree in business administration, operations, or a related field preferred
  • Three or more years of multi-unit or district management experience in a related industry
  • Demonstrated ability to manage profit and loss across multiple Pennsylvania locations
  • Experience with workforce scheduling, hiring, and performance management for large teams
  • Proficiency with inventory management systems and operational reporting tools
  • Willingness to travel regularly within an assigned Pennsylvania district or region

Area Manager Jobs in Pennsylvania: Frequently Asked Questions

How do you become a area manager in Pennsylvania?

Most area manager roles in Pennsylvania require a bachelor's degree in business, operations, retail management, or a closely related field, though significant hands-on management experience can substitute at many employers. Pennsylvania does not issue a state license specifically for area managers, so the path runs through progressive store or department management roles at companies like Giant Food Stores, Wawa, or regional distribution operators before stepping into district oversight.

Are there remote area manager jobs in Pennsylvania?

Yes, but they're rare. Area manager work is fundamentally on-site because the role requires in-person oversight of staff, facilities, and operations across multiple locations. About 25% of area manager openings tied to Pennsylvania are remote or hybrid as of August 2026, and those positions tend to be limited to the reporting, analytics, and vendor coordination components of the role rather than full remote arrangements.

How can I get hired as a area manager in Pennsylvania with little or no experience?

The most realistic entry path is to build a record as a store manager, department supervisor, or assistant manager at a Pennsylvania employer before moving into area oversight. Companies like Wawa, Giant Food Stores, and large logistics operators in the Lehigh Valley run structured management development programs that move high-performing shift leads and assistant managers into district-level roles. Earning a Certified Manager credential through the Institute of Certified Professional Managers strengthens a candidate's profile when experience is still limited.
